Fact Checks (2)
"The Muslim Brotherhood, @BarackObama's allies in Egypt"
Mostly False

The Obama administration engaged diplomatically with the Muslim Brotherhood as part of pragmatic outreach to emerging political actors after Mubarak's fall. This does not constitute an 'alliance.' The administration maintained relationships with Egyptian military, secular opposition, and Brotherhood simultaneously. U.S. maintained .3B annual military aid to Egyptian armed forces throughout this period.

"[Muslim Brotherhood] will cancel the Camp David Agreement"
False

This prediction proved incorrect. Mohamed Morsi, the Muslim Brotherhood candidate, became Egypt's president in June 2012 and served until July 2013. During this period, the Camp David Accords remained in effect. Morsi upheld the peace treaty with Israel. While Brotherhood officials made contradictory statements in early 2012, when actually in power they maintained the treaty.
